Output 296689dfe1e1483cca121c1adbcad81659ad5b5081becb12072d35335305b7eb:1

value
20973105623
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21f2fc9423436bbedd04ed64c418c42d9ed2808f OP_EQUALVERIFY OP_CHECKSIG
address
146WPLbPubHJrEquk9xt32Yy8J2atHzsyT
transaction
296689dfe1e1483cca121c1adbcad81659ad5b5081becb12072d35335305b7eb
spent
true